streamlined container interface (trunk only)

Reduce the number of questions issued when applying or looting a
container, and offer the opportunity to put things inside before taking
things out.  Instead of "Do you want to take something out?  [:ynq]",
followed by "Do you want to put something in? [ynq]", this gives just one
prompt; the result is similar to menustyle:full where you start out by
choosing between out, in, and both.  There are now two additional choices:
reversed, for both in the opposite order, and stash, to put a single item
inside.  Prompt phrasing is rather clumsy; I wanted to keep it short:
"Do what with <the container>? [:oibrsq or ?]", where picking '?' pops
up a brief help window.  Inappropriate choices (like 'o'and 'b' when
container is empty) are suppressed from the prompt but still acceptable as
input; " or ?" is suppressed if the cmdassist option has been toggled off,
but entering '?' still works to get help.

     Menu mode wouldn't allow 'b' when inventory was empty, despite the
fact that first taking things out might change that.  Now 'b' is a viable
choice if the container isn't empty, and the new 'r' is a vialble choice
when inventory isn't empty even if the container is.
